Human Neuroblastoma cell line GIMEN (Synonyms: Gi-ME-N; Gimen; Gimen1)  Organism:Homo sapiens (human) Ethnicity:Caucasian Age:3.5 years Gender:Female Tissue:Neuroblastoma Morphology:Epithelial Cell type:Neuroblastoma Growth Properties:Monolayer, adherent Description:This cell line was established from a bone marrow specimen of a stage IV neuroblastoma after six months of chemotherapy. Proliferation of Gimen cells is inhibited by IFN; FGF-2 is antimitogenic for them. IFN gamma reverses and IL-1 beta enhances this antimitogenic effect of FGF-2 (Scheil, 1994).

Human Brain Neuroblastoma cell line  Organism:Homo sapiens (human) Ethnicity:Caucasian Age:13 months old Gender:Male Tissue:Brain Morphology:Fibroblast Cell type:Neuroblastoma; Neuroblast, Fibroblast Growth Properties:Monolayer, adherent Description:There are two cell types present. A small neuroblast- like cell is predominant, and the other one is a large hyaline fibroblast. This cell line can be propagated to >80 serial subcultures.

Human Brain Neuroblastoma cell line Kelly  Organism:Homo sapiens (human) Ethnicity:Caucasian Tissue:Brain Morphology:Adherent Celltype:Neuroblastoma Growth Properties:Monolayer, adherent Description:The Kelly cell line has been established from a patient with neuroblastoma. They possess a genomic amplification of the N-myc gene.

Human Neuroblastoma cell line SH-SY5Y  Organism:Homo sapiens (human) Age:4 years old Gender:Female Tissue:Brain (from metastatic site: bone marrow) Morphology:The cells grow as clusters of neuroblastic cells with multiple, short, fine cell processes (neurites). Cells will aggregate, form clumps and float; a confluent monolayer is not formed. Cell type:Neuroblast (neuroblastoma) Growth Properties:Loosely adherent; form clumps at high cell density Description:SH-SY5Y is one of three serially isolated neuroblast clones (SH-SY, SH-SY5, SH-SY5Y) of the human neuroblastoma cell line SK-N-SH which was established in 1970 from a metastatic bone tumor. The cells exhibit moderate levels of dopamine beta hydroxylase activity. They can convert glutamate to the neurotransmitter GABA. SH-SY5Y cells have a reported saturation density greater than 1 x 106 cells/cm2. The loss of neuronal characteristics has been described with increasing passage numbers (approx. passage 20). Neuronal markers or uptake of noradrenalin should be determined routinely. It is recommended not to use at passage numbers higher than 20 unless neuronal characteristics are controlled. Virus:The presence of SMRV in SH-SY5Y was detected at CLS by qPCR. Biosafety level:Although there is no incidince of infections of hosts other than Squirrel Monkey, it is recommended to handle SH-SY5Y cells as a potentially biohazardous material under Biosafety Level 2 containment.
